I think you have happened upon a default naming algorithm
that kicks off when Castor doesn't have a mapping file
or compiled *Descriptor.class files.
If you're using the sourcegenerator, be sure that
the generated *Descriptor.java files are
compiled and the .class files are in the classpath at runtime.
